Administrator reports Stillwater Dam steps installed, America 250 grant awarded and $13,000 estimate for pole/traffic-light repairs
Summary
Village Administrator Jordan Hodges reported Finfrock Construction installed steps at Stillwater Dam, said remaining dam funding will be used next year, announced an America 250 Community Grant for three 2026 events, and estimated about $13,000 to repair a damaged light pole and traffic light.

Village Administrator Jordan Hodges updated council on multiple public-works and community items at the Oct. 20 meeting. He said photos show steps were installed at Stillwater Dam by Finfrock Construction and that some funding remains to support follow-up items next year. Hodges also reported asphalt work was completed in the village wellfields.
Hodges announced the village received an America 250 Community Grant, which will help fund three events next year to highlight Covington’s history. He added that newly ordered American flags arrived and that the village decided to replace all flags at once. Hodges noted a damaged light pole and a traffic light that will cost about $13,000 to repair and said he would look into replacement options.
Hodges closed his update with reminders about upcoming community dates: trick-or-treat on Oct. 30 from 6:00 to 8:00 PM and that polls will be open Nov. 4 from 6:30 AM to 7:30 PM.
